#include <vfs/mount.h>
#include <ubixos/vitals.h>
#include <ubixos/kpanic.h>
#include <lib/kmalloc.h>
#include <lib/kprintf.h>
#include <lib/string.h>
#include <sys/device.h>

/************************************************************************

 Function: mount(int driveId,int partition,int fsType,char *mountPoint,char *perms)

 Description: mount adds a mount point and returns 0 if successful 1 if it fails

 Notes:

 ************************************************************************/
int vfs_mount( int major, int minor, int partition, int vfsType, char *mountPoint, char *perms ) {
  struct vfs_mountPoint *mp = 0x0;
  struct device_node *device = 0x0;

  /* Allocate Memory For Mount Point */
  if ( (mp = (struct vfs_mountPoint *) kmalloc( sizeof(struct vfs_mountPoint) )) == NULL )
    kprintf( "vfs_mount: failed to allocate mp\n" );

  /* Copy Mount Point Into Buffer */
  sprintf( mp->mountPoint, mountPoint );

  /* Set Pointer To Physical Drive */
  device = device_find( major, minor );

  /* Set Up Mp Defaults */
  mp->device = device;
  mp->fs = (struct fileSystem *) vfsFindFS( vfsType );
  mp->partition = partition;
  mp->perms = *perms;

  if ( mp->fs == 0x0 ) {
    /* sysErr(systemErr,"File System Type: %i Not Found\n",fsType); */
    kprintf( "File System Type: %i Not Found\n", vfsType );
    return (0x1);
  }
  /*What is this for? 10/6/2006 */
  /*
   if (device != 0x0) {
   mp->diskLabel = (struct ubixDiskLabel *)kmalloc(512);
   mp->device->devInfo->read(mp->device->devInfo->info,mp->diskLabel,1,1);
   kprintf("READING SECTOR");
   }
   */

  /* Add Mountpoint If It Fails Free And Return */
  if ( vfs_addMount( mp ) != 0x0 ) {
    kfree( mp );
    return (0x1);
  }

  /* Initialize The File System If It Fails Return */
  if ( mp->fs->vfsInitFS( mp ) == 0x0 ) {
    kfree( mp );
    return (0x1);
  }
  /* Return */
  return (0x0);
}

/************************************************************************

 Function: vfs_addMount(struct vfs_mountPoint *mp)

 Description: This function adds a mount point to the system

 Notes:

 ************************************************************************/
int vfs_addMount( struct vfs_mountPoint *mp ) {

  /* If There Are No Existing Mounts Make It The First */
  if ( systemVitals->mountPoints == 0x0 ) {
    mp->prev = 0x0;
    mp->next = 0x0;
    systemVitals->mountPoints = mp;
  }
  else {
    mp->next = systemVitals->mountPoints;
    systemVitals->mountPoints->prev = mp;
    mp->prev = 0x0;
    systemVitals->mountPoints = mp;
  }
  /* Return */
  return (0x0);
}

/************************************************************************

 Function: vfs_findMount(char *mountPoint)

 Description: This function finds a particular mount point

 Notes:

 ************************************************************************/
struct vfs_mountPoint *vfs_findMount( char *mountPoint ) {
  struct vfs_mountPoint *tmpMp = 0x0;

  for ( tmpMp = systemVitals->mountPoints; tmpMp; tmpMp = tmpMp->next ) {
    if ( strcmp( tmpMp->mountPoint, mountPoint ) == 0x0 ) {
      return (tmpMp);
    }
  }
  /* Return NULL If Mount Point Not Found */
  return NULL;
}
